One of the mid-level priced elliptical machines out there in the exercise market is the Schwinn 431 elliptical trainer machine. If you are thinking of buying this machine, here are some finer points that you may want to consider.
Closer look at Schwinn 431 elliptical trainer
This Schwinn 431 Elliptical Trainer machine uses Eddy Current Brakes or ECB for its resistance. This fly wheel resistance lasts longer than the belt tension that some of the cheap elliptical machines use. This makes it a good buy for those planning to use the machine for a good long time.
The Schwinn 431 elliptical machine also has a built in back lit LCD monitor that will allow you to check your details like the speed, heart rate, calories burned, distance, etc. Note also that this console also has a towel hook and your personal fan for your own convenience.

Take a look at elliptical fitness equipment or elliptical trainers as they are more popularly know.
The elliptical trainer craze started out in the latter part of the last millennium. By 2004, over 10,000 Americans are already working out using elliptical trainers. More and more people, including fitness buffs and those aiming for weight-loss, were looking into the latest trends in elliptical fitness equipment. Local gyms have taken to including elliptical trainers in their inventory of exercise machines. In-shop and online sales of elliptical trainers, whether priced at below $1000 or over $2000, have soared. Today, the craze continues with a lot more features and improvements on the elliptical trainers are being introduced.
